Dash shell document

WebDec 3, 2024 · In a shell script, you may want to use indentation to make the code … WebMar 2, 2024 · There are some utilities that accept a --(double dash) as the signal for "end …

Dash equivalent of self-redirection of script output

WebA shell allows execution of gnu commands, both synchronously and asynchronously. … WebMar 8, 2024 · Here document ( Heredoc) is an input or file stream literal that is treated … can criminal mischief charges be dropped https://skinnerlawcenter.com

DashAsBinSh - Ubuntu Wiki

Webdash is the standard command interpreter for the system. The current version of dash … WebProcess substitution just amounts to an argument that points to a /dev/fd/ [num] link to an anonymous pipe. dash does here-documents with anonymous pipes rather than genning temp files as most other shells do. So cat /dev/fd/3 3< WebDec 16, 2024 · You can use dash -n to check that a script will run under dash without … can criminal record be cleared

Bash Reference Manual

Category:Dash for macOS - API Documentation Browser, …

Tags:Dash shell document

Dash shell document

YAML Syntax — Ansible Documentation

WebApr 1, 2024 · Moreover, dash, the most common non-bash /bin/sh implementation on Linux, already has the functionality built-in, as you can test below: dash -s &lt;&lt;'EOF' PS4=':$LINENO+'; set -x echo "First line" echo "Second line" EOF ...correctly emits (with dash 0.5.10.2): :2+echo First line First line :3+echo Second line Second line Share … WebDec 2, 2024 · dash is the Debian Almquist shell: a small, fast, and POSIX compliant shell. It is well-suited for startup scripts, and is used on Debian (and derivative distributions) as /bin/sh . As some shell scripts may have "bashisms" in them, dash is not guaranteed to work as a /bin/sh replacement on Gentoo, out-of-the-box.

Dash shell document

Did you know?

WebTable The dash Shell Built-In CommandsYou probably recognize all of these built-in … WebSep 26, 2024 · A simple rule of thumb is: if your script was written in bash, do not assume it will work in dash. A full list of differences is beyond the scope of a simple Q&amp;A, but essentially, dash is a POSIX shell, so it implements what is described in the POSIX specification for the shell language and only that.

WebSep 11, 2024 · To get it to work in dash you need to resort to older solutions (here-doc): $ read X Y &lt;&lt;_EOT_ &gt; AAA BBB &gt; _EOT_ $ echo "&lt;$X&gt;" As a command to try shells (sadly the newlines can not be removed (no one-liner)): $ bash -c 'read X Y &lt;&lt;_EOT_ AAA BBB _EOT_ echo "&lt;$X&gt;" ' That works exactly the same in dash, zsh, ksh, and … WebDec 10, 2024 · The Dash to Dock extension has a wide range of optional features and tweaks that users can enable and change. Some of the tweakable items include: icon size, where to position the dock (including on multiple monitors), opacity of the dock, and themes. Accessing the settings dialog for the extension is easy.

WebMar 3, 2024 · Adding the dash removes the tab indent and outputs the message without the leading spaces. Note: If the text shows up with the leading spaces, press TAB instead of copying and pasting the example code. Inside Statements and Loops When working with a HereDoc inside statements and loops, keep in mind the following behavior: WebFor Ansible, nearly every YAML file starts with a list. Each item in the list is a list of key/value pairs, commonly called a “hash” or a “dictionary”. So, we need to know how to write lists and dictionaries in YAML. There’s another small quirk to YAML.

WebDash is an API Documentation Browser and Code Snippet Manager. Dash instantly searches offline documentation sets for 200+ APIs, 100+ cheat sheets and more. You can even generate your own docsets or request …

WebMar 3, 2024 · Debian developed a shell environment based on ash and called it “dash”. It’s designed to be POSIX-compliant and lightweight, so … fish mercury poisoning symptomsWebOct 13, 2016 · This shows that 'sh' is a symlink to 'dash', and that /bin/bash, which is the default interactive shell on Ubuntu, is an executable that is almost 9 time bigger than /bin/sh. Indeed, 'man sh' (1590 lines) vs 'man bash' (5459 lines) reveals that bash is a large superset of the traditional 'sh'. Read more here: bash on wikipedia dash on wikipedia can cricut vinyl be used on shirtsWebMay 28, 2024 · dash is a very strict POSIX shell, if it work in dash it is almost certain it would work in other POSIX shell. Try: if [ "$var" = "string" ] then some_command fi Share Improve this answer Follow edited May 28, 2015 at 19:56 cwd 52.2k 53 160 197 answered Jul 7, 2009 at 0:33 J-16 SDiZ 26.2k 4 64 84 6 fish messe bremenWebNov 19, 2024 · Dash stands for Debian Almquist Shell. It is a POSIX-compliant … fish messeWebDash (Debian Almquist shell) is a modern POSIX-compliant implementation of /bin/sh (sh, Bourne shell) . Dash is not Bash compatible, but Bash tries to be mostly compatible with POSIX, and thus Dash. Dash shines in: Speed of execution. Roughly 4x times faster … can crimson play with platWebNov 26, 2024 · On the other hand, the Dash shell is a simplistic modern POSIX … fish merchant singaporeWebMar 2, 2024 · There are some utilities that accept a -- (double dash) as the signal for "end of options", required when a file name starts with a dash: $ echo "Hello World!" >-file $ cat -- -file Hello World! $ cat -file # cat - -file fails in the same way. cat: invalid option -- 'f' Try 'cat --help' for more information. fish mersea island